Plural
prickles
1
a small, sharp-pointed structure that grows on the surface of a plant
- Roses are known for their thorns, which are actually prickles that help protect the plant from being eaten by animals.
- Cacti have numerous prickles covering their surface, which help reduce water loss and deter herbivores from feeding on them.
- The stem of a blackberry bush is covered in prickles, making it difficult for animals to reach the fruit without getting scratched.
- Some species of nettles have stinging hairs that act as prickles, delivering a painful sting when touched.
- The leaves of a holly plant have prickles along the edges, providing defense against browsing animals.
